About Borealis Philanthropy

Borealis Philanthropy is a philanthropic social justice intermediary that works to resource grassroots leaders and social justice movements for transformative change. We help funders expand their reach and strengthen their impact through donor collaboratives that support a variety of issues, communities, and movements. Borealis is comprised of several intersecting donor collaboratives, including the Disability Inclusion Fund and its initiative, Disability x Tech.

About the Disability Inclusion Fund

The DIF supports U.S.-based groups run by and for people with disabilities to lead transformational change. The Fund is supported by donors including the Presidents’ Council on Disability Inclusion in Philanthropy, which is comprised of foundation presidents who are committed to disability inclusion as part of improving diversity, equity, and inclusion within philanthropy.

Part of the efforts of disability rights and justice includes the ways disability and technology are working towards shared goals in our movements. This initiative is housed at the DIF and supported by Ford Foundation’s Technology & Society Program and the MacArthur Foundation’s Technology in the Public Interest Program.

The Disability x Tech initiative exists because we believe that in order for a world where true technology and disability justice are realized, we must support disabled leaders, and disability-led organizations, working to ensure technology can be used by everyone in order to fully participate in our society. We also believe that such a world would be a place where technology is free from perpetuating ableist biases, algorithmic discrimination, and other forms of disparate treatment towards disabled people that contribute to further marginalization.
